Pylon is a Series B, AI-native B2B company building the next generation of customer support.

Legacy platforms like Zendesk and Salesforce Service Cloud were built around tickets. Pylon is built around accounts, real-time collaboration, and AI-driven customer intelligence.

This is a massive market with incumbents that weren’t designed for AI-first workflows.

Company
  • Series B, $51M raised

  • Backed by a16z, BCV, General Catalyst, Y Combinator

  • 90 employees

  • Sales team: 11 AEs, 6 SDRs

  • Offices in San Francisco and New York City

The Role
  • Own full-cycle sales for inbound and outbound opportunities

  • Source a portion of your own pipeline via outbound

  • Sell to B2B tech companies (<500 employees), with exposure to larger accounts over time

  • Run discovery, demos, trials (1–2 weeks), and close

Requirements
  • 2+ years of SaaS sales experience

  • Experience selling $10k–$100k ARR deals

  • Comfortable with outbound prospecting

  • Able to sell differentiated, technical products

  • Based in SF or NYC and willing to work in-person

Nice to Haves
  • Sold into competitive markets

  • Experience selling to Support, Success, or Post-Sales teams

  • Familiarity with AI-driven products

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
